Ever wondered how a simple grape could lead to unforgettable adventures and laughter-inducing stories? Join us as we uncork our shared passion for wine, reminiscing about our favorite reds from Paso Robles and the delightful crispness of Sauvignon Blanc and Pinot Grigio. We reveal why Chardonnay has become our playful code word, and take you on a journey through some of our most cherished wine-tasting escapades, from an intimate vineyard tour in Greece to the diverse offerings of Napa's wineries and even dreaming about grape stomping in Italy. Our tales are filled with laughter and the warmth of loved ones, highlighting how these liquid experiences have woven their way into our family memories.
If you think wine is the only drink worth talking about, let us surprise you. Picture this: Meghan & Brittany visit to a meadery where the mead was as memorable as it was unpalatable. Yet, it's moments like these, juxtaposed with heartwarming drinking rituals in Vietnam—where "mo hai bai yo" became the soundtrack to our evenings—that show how the setting and company craft stories that last a lifetime. Whether the drink is fabulous or less than stellar, the stories and camaraderie they inspire are always worth toasting to. So, grab your favorite beverage and join us for a lively episode filled with humor, adventure, and toasts to both the expected and unexpected joys of our drinking journeys.

Brittany:I love that. All right, moving away from like the basic red white wines, we're going international. So have you ever heard of grappa? Oh my, gosh.
Meghan:So I've heard of grappa. I haven't't had it, but I have had ozu, which I think is the greece version of grappa, and my goodness, do I have some stories?
Brittany:yes, you're right. So if you don't know what grappa is, or even ozu, it's pretty much like the leftover of the wine, so it's pretty much moonshine, right, let's get real about it. And, holy shit, that will light you up. The first time I drank it was with my dad and he was like all right, you have to try this. So I'm at this restaurant in Sausalito called the Trident and it's like super cool, right, it's all like seventies, eighties, like not themed, but like they had a lot of artists from that time go there, it sits on the water, it's beautiful. We had this great dinner and it's like an after dinner drink, right. And so they pour it in like little, like shot glasses, and you're like okay, cool, whatever, you have one of those and like you are done.
Meghan:Well, in Greece it's called Ozu, but I don't know if it's technically called wine. So we're sneaking it into this podcast because it's like clear liquid. But let me tell you, like some of the restaurants it's like gasoline and then some of it is like so incredibly smooth, so you really never know what you get. Moonshine is absolutely an accurate word, but it's like the dinner mint at every restaurant. Like you get the check, you get some Ozu and then you find out am I going to die?
Meghan:with gasoline, or is it going to be delicious, right, but it was a really fun experience. I love like little dinner mints, I feel like the hair growing on my chest every time I drink it, just for like perspective.
